# Basement Archive Room — Night Access

The archive room under Pellworth House holds old contracts and the tape backups. Night shift: take stairwell C, not the lift (it's switched off after midnight). Lights are on a timer by the door — slap the button as you go in. Sign the logbook, even at 3am, yes really. The keypad by the door takes the code below.

staff pass of fahap-tajeg = bdg-FT-6

CI note — Parityscope checker

Heads up: the hotel rate-parity checker has been red on the nightly run since Tuesday. It's not the scraper — the mock rate feed in the test harness started returning rates in minor currency units, so every comparison trips the mismatch threshold. Quick fix is to pin the harness to the previous fixture set and rerun. Longer term, Odalie is normalizing units in the comparator itself. If it's still red after the fixture pin, page the Bellcrest platform channel and quote the trace token below.

session token of hawif-bajog = htk6_9ab8da

Staging for the Quillbend public API returns unpaginated results because PAGE_LIMIT_ENFORCED was never set there, unlike production. The fix adds the flag, but the pagination cursor signer also needs its signing secret present or every cursor 400s. Reviewer: please verify the env file diff includes the flag, then the signing secret directly beneath it.

secret setting of hawep-yahig: LEDGER_TOKEN29=41b5d6315371c92885eaeb077fb63

Subject: Quota cut-over complete

Hi all — quick summary for anyone who joined after the Threadmark cut-over. We moved per-tenant rate quotas from the old static table to the Cinderhook quota service last Tuesday. Enforcement now happens at the gateway, so tenants hitting their ceiling get a clean 429 with a retry hint instead of silent throttling. Legacy overrides were migrated automatically; a handful of enterprise tenants kept custom ceilings. If you need to reproduce the rollout locally, the gateway expects the following configuration.

config for tajof-yaguf:
[istox]
team = aldius
access_code = ac_29be1b
owner = holok.praix
host = istox.zarqelsoft.test
port = 11211
peer = novath.olvarqio.example
salt = 983a9dc6
pin = 4652